Definitions from Wiktionary (motherhouse)

noun:  The monastery from which the other 'houses' of a religious order or congregation were (directly or indirectly) founded, often eponymous.
noun:  The convent which is the seat (and often the above original foundation) of the superior of an order or congregation, and/or on which lower ranking houses (such as priories under an abbot) depend.
